On , OSHA opened a complaint safety inspection of LAZ CONSTRUCTION in 948 N PLAYER AVE, EAGLE, ID 83616 (NAICS 236118). OSHA activity number 339614059.
OSHA opens inspections for many reasons: rout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

Citations
2 citations on file for this inspection.
1926.501 B13
- Issued
- Mar 10, 2014
- Abate by
- Mar 27, 2014
- Penalty
- Initial $1,600 · Current $1,100 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.501(b)(13): Each employee engaged in residential construction activities 6 feet (1.8 m) or more above lower levels was not protected by guardrail systems, safety net system, or personal fall arrest system unless another provision in paragraph (b) of this section provided for an alternative fall protection measure. a) On or about March 6, 2014, Residential Construction Site at 948 N Player Ave, Eagle, Idaho: Employees were working on a 5:12 pitch roof without means of fall protection in the workplace. The potential fall distance employees were exposed to was measured at 8 and 9 feet at the eaves dependent on work location. Abatement certification is required for this item.

1926.503 B01
- Issued
- Mar 10, 2014
- Abate by
- Mar 27, 2014
- Penalty
- Initial $0 · Current $0
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.503(b)(1) The employer did not verify compliance with paragraph (a) of this section by preparing a written certification record. a) On or about March 6, 2014, Residential Construction Site at 948 N Player Ave, Eagle, Idaho: The employer did not have a written certification of training for employees who were exposed to fall hazards over 6 feet. The employer did not have a written certification record that contained the name or other identity of the employee trained, the date(s) of the training, and the signature of the person who conducted the training or the signature of the employer. Abatement certification is required for this item.
